Core sheath combination yarn

Introduction to core sheath combination yarn

Core-sheath combination yarn is a specialized type of yarn consisting of two distinct components: the core and the sheath. The core, typically made of a different material or fiber than the sheath, forms the innermost part of the yarn. It provides specific properties such as strength, elasticity, or moisture management. The sheath, on the other hand, surrounds the core, acting as a protective outer layer.

This yarn is produced through a spinning process where the core material is encased within the sheath material. The two components are spun together to form a single yarn strand with the core securely housed within the sheath

Properties of core sheath combination yarn

  • Strength: Exhibits excellent durability and resistance to tension and abrasion.
  • Flexibility: Maintains flexibility for various weaving or knitting techniques.
  • Moisture Management: Offers effective moisture-wicking properties for dry and comfortable fabrics.
  • Softness: Provides a soft and comfortable feel against the skin.
  • Better Appearance: Contributes to smooth and uniform fabric surfaces for aesthetic appeal.
  • Thermal Regulation: Helps regulate body temperature for comfort in different conditions.
  • Abrasion Resistance: Withstands wear and tear for long-lasting durability.
  • Customization: Allows for customized solutions by selecting specific materials for desired properties.

Application of core sheath combination yarn

  • Apparel: Used in activewear and sportswear for strength and flexibility.
  • Technical Textiles: Employed in outdoor gear for durability and moisture management.
  • Automotive Interiors: Used in upholstery for durability and appearance.
  • Home Furnishings: Employed in curtains for softness and durability.
  • Industrial Fabrics: Utilized in conveyor belts for strength and abrasion resistance.
  • Geotextiles: Used in erosion control for durability and environmental resistance.
  • Protective Clothing: Employed in safety vests for protection and comfort.

Types of core sheath combination yarn

  • Polyester Core with Nylon Sheath
  • Spandex Core with Polyester Sheath
  • Cotton Core with Polyester Sheath
  • Polypropylene Core with Polyethylene Sheath
  • Viscose Core with Modal Sheath
